Ecuador Presidential Election Heads to Runoff Amidst Violence and Polarization

Ecuador is set for a presidential runoff as the conservative incumbent Daniel Noboa faces off against leftist lawyer Luisa González following a tightly contested first round of voting. The election has been marked by significant challenges, including rising drug-related gang violence, which has critically influenced the political landscape. Voters are heading to the polls against a backdrop of chaos characterized by murder, blackouts, and security crises. The elections have raised questions about the future direction of Ecuador, particularly concerning the fight against organized crime and the environmental implications of leadership choices. As tensions rise, many voters, affected by violence, are looking for stability and effective governance in the upcoming decision.
